Full Job Description
We are seeking highly motivated and detail-oriented software engineers to join our chip simulation team. As an engineer on this team, you will design, develop, and test simulations of our custom hardware. Our team plays a key role in hardware-software co-design, enabling early development of the full software stack. Join us to shape the future of AI hardware abstraction and optimization! What You'll Do Here • Design and implement a Rust-based chip simulator, building a cycle-accurate model of our custom hardware • Collaborate with simulator customers: architecture, verification/validation, compiler, and runtime teams • Work closely with hardware architects, building models that shape the silicon design • Build tooling and infrastructure to aid in efficient correlation, debug, and testing • Use AI development tools to accelerate your work Who You Are • Bachelor of Computer Science or an equivalent degree • 5+ years of software development experience • Skilled in Rust, or strongly interested in ramping up • Outstanding software engineering skills, with a focus on maintainability and performance • Strong foundation in computer architecture fundamentals • Excellent cross-functional communication skills • Able to work from our Mountain View, CA office three days a week (Tuesday-Thursday) as part of this hybrid role Bonus Points If You Have • Experience writing cycle-accurate simulators • Deep knowledge of ML accelerator architectures • Experience with benchmarking and optimizing Rust code • Familiarity with processor, memory, and networking architectures • An understanding of power, performance, and cost tradeoffs Compensation The US base salary for this full-time position is determined based on a variety of factors including role, experience, location, job related skills, and relevant education and training.
